i just installed windows 7 64 bit os.. now i want update my internet explorer 7 to internet explorer 10.. but it`s telling "Internet explorer 10 can only be installed on windows 7 service pack 1 or higher" how can i update it without installing win 7 sp1????? please help me soon...

You have to do all the updates available before it will let you install IE 11. I just did a Windows 7 reinstall last week and all the updates and restarts took forever but just keep running Windows Update until it finishes and then IE 11 will be available.
Well Windows 7 came with IE8 out of the box, but the latest IE for Windows 7 is actually IE11 now.

As to the other question.. install the service pack. You should do that anyway to get the latest updates and support. It might take about an hour depending on your specs but won't break anything. (it's just a free update from Microsoft Update)
